About this course:

The most important step in selling an idea or script is creating the perfect pitch document. This document can serve as a guide for yourself during your verbal pitch, but it can also be a roadmap for your pilot and series once it is sold. In this workshop, you take your television show idea or pilot script as a foundation to create a professional pitch document. You learn the perfect way to introduce yourself and your idea, elaborate on your show’s premise, describe the world of show, create detailed character descriptions, expound on episode ideas and finally demonstrate your show’s tone by comparing it to other shows. We also discuss how to use your pitch document and the requirements of studios, networks and streamers and the WGA “no free work” rule. By the end of the course, you have a completed pitch document. Students must have either an idea for a TV series or a completed TV pilot at the start of the course.
